Our Mission

Friends for Mental Health, is a bilingual, grass-root self-help community group for families of people with a mental illness. Created 25 years ago by parents of mentally ill persons, our association is the only one in our area offering direct support to these families. Our purpose is to provide practical information, education, supportive counseling, group support, and respite to help families better cope with their situation. We also work to educate the community at large about mental illness and help them to understand how it affects them and their loved ones. We are an integral player in the delivery of mental health services within the community and work collaboratively with other mental health agencies. In addition, we are a pivotal force for getting ill people into treatment, referrals and follow-up services given by other organizations and institutions.
